Hound's Tongue Cynoglossi herba
Hundszungenkraut
Published March 2, 1989
Name of Drug
Cynoglossi herba, hound's tongue.
Composition of Drug
Hound's Tongue herb consists of the above-ground parts of Cynoglossum officinale L. (syn. C. clandestinum Desfontaines) [Fam. Boraginaceae], as well as preparations thereof.
Uses
Preparations of Hound's Tongue are used as an antidiarrheal and an expectorant.
Fixed combinations containing Hound's Tongue are used for ailments and complaints of the gastrointestinal tract, infections, skin diseases, and bronchitis; and externally for diseases and painful discomfort of extremities, myalgia, neuralgia, trauma, nervous diseases, and care of scar tissue.
The effectiveness of the herb for the claimed applications is not documented.
Risks
Hound's Tongue contains large amounts of the hepatotoxic pyrrolizidine alkaloids.
Evaluation
Since the effectiveness for the claimed applications is not documented, a therapeutic administration cannot be justified due to the risks.
